Description
This Executive Assistant will provide high quality administrative and coordination support to the Member Services team and support the Senior Executive Assistant. Responsibilities include managing meeting logistics and conference arrangements, preparing and finalizing presentations, coordinating expenses, and assisting with team activities and events to support collaboration and engagement.
Who You’ll Work WithThe Executive Assistant will report to the Senior Executive Assistant, Member Services.
What You’ll Do- Prepare meeting materials and coordinate agendas
Take meeting minutes, as required
Manage travel arrangements for the director or vice president
Manage group registrations for conferences, flights and hotels for the department
Process and record invoices for the department
Prepare monthly expense reports
Review and prioritize incoming correspondence for the director or vice president
Provide dedicated administrative support for All Councils Meetings and MS Forward meetings (Directors & Senior Managers)
Prepare meeting materials, coordinate agendas, and compile and finalize presentations for meetings and committees
Coordinate room bookings and catering using Outlook and Momentus for team meetings and events
Provide administrative support to the Senior Executive Assistant and leadership team within Member Services
Provide coverage during vacation and time-off periods, as required
Plan and coordinate offsite meetings, team activities, and events
Coordinate gift cards, rewards, and recognition activities
Degree in a related field is an asset\
A minimum of 1-2years of administrative assistance support
Excellent MS Office Skills: Word, Excel and PowerPoint
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Outlook, PowerPoint, Excel, and Word) and proficiency with collaboration and productivity tools such as Teams, SharePoint, ChatGPT, and Copilot, with the ability to adapt to and learn new technologies.
Exceptional time management and organizational skills with strong attention to detail.
Ability to communicate effectively and professionally with stakeholders at all levels.
Strong problem-solving skills and the ability to manage competing priorities under tight deadlines.
Ability to always maintain discretion and confidentiality on a wide range of issues.
Ability to identify and prioritize items requiring immediate action, along with any pertinent information to facilitate decision making.
Strong customer service orientation; a flexible and willing ‘can do’ attitude.
Proven ability to work independently on multiple tasks while demonstrating initiative.
What we’re offering

Pay-for-performance with base salary and annual incentive based on individual and enterprise performance.

The Base Salary range for this level is as follows:
$60,000 - $95,000.

Individual compensation and placement of this role in the range is based on different factors unique to each candidate, including but not limited to relevant experience, skills, demonstrated competencies, and internal equity as they relate to the role.Numerous opportunities for professional growth and development
Comprehensive employer paid benefits coverage
Retirement income through a defined benefit pension plan
The opportunity to invest back into the fund through our Deferred Incentive Program
A flexible work environment combining in office collaboration and remote working
Competitive time off
Our Flexible Travel Program gives you the option to work abroad in another region/country for up to a month each year
Employee discount programs including Edvantage and Perkopolis
